Business intelligence systems help organizations transform raw data into meaningful insights that support strategic planning.
Companies collect information from sales records, customer interactions, and operational systems. Data analytics tools evaluate this information to identify patterns and trends.
Managers use business intelligence dashboards to monitor performance indicators such as revenue growth, operational efficiency, and customer satisfaction.
Predictive analytics also supports decision-making by forecasting market demand and identifying potential risks.
Technology platforms integrate data from multiple departments to create unified reporting systems.
Organizations that use data-driven strategies often achieve stronger performance because decisions rely on measurable information rather than assumptions.
